MCP tools · 6 exposed · ~836 tokens

The tools this component advertises to a client, with an estimated token cost for each. Expand a tool to see its parameters and schema. The per-tool counts are indicative and are not scored directly; the schema's total context footprint is one signal in Schema Quality & AI Usability.

Tool Tokens
book_intro_call ~74

The second legitimate ending besides request_offer: a direct booking link for a 1:1 intro meeting with Marian Kamenistak, ELC's founder. Offer it whenever the visitor hesitates, wants a human, or the package needs tailoring beyond the catalog. No contact details collected here — the booking page handles everything.

Input schema present but exposes no named parameters.

No output schema declared.

No examples provided.

customize_package ~120

The conversational toggle board. Pass the preset and the item ids currently ON; returns the recomputed total (never trust your own arithmetic — this is the authoritative price), every selected item with its price, and what else this tier could add. Items marked foundation anchor the package; advise keeping them. Call again after every change the visitor asks for. Next: request_offer.

design_journey ~157

The moment the package becomes a year: deterministic month-by-month plan of what lands when, computed from the basket's own scheduling metadata (lead times, anchors like the April 2027 conference, spacing, and heavy-event collision rules). Returns placed months, the recurring-every-month layer, and anything unplaceable WITH its reason. The plan contains ONLY items in the basket — narrate around it, never add or move an event. Call after customize_package, before request_offer.

get_partnership_options ~82

START HERE for any company considering an ELC partnership or membership (personas: HR, CTO, employer branding). Returns how company membership works, real community reach figures, and the two qualifying questions with their valid answers. Companies only — individuals seeking a mentor for themselves get pointed to /mentor/ instead. After the visitor answers both questions, call match_package.

match_package ~129

Resolves goal + budget through ELC's own routing matrix — the same one the website uses — and returns the matched package(s) with real prices and their default line items. Map free-text answers to the closest valid id; on bad input the error lists the valid ids, re-ask rather than guessing. Next: customize_package to toggle line items, or request_offer to send it as-is.

request_offer ~274

The ONLY tool that collects contact details, and the step that makes the AI-channel discount real. Sends the itemized offer to the visitor's email, notifies Marian (email + Slack), and files the company into ELC's partners queue. Ask for name, work email and company only when the visitor says they want the offer — never earlier. After success: share the confirmation, then make ONE optional ask: would they post publicly (LinkedIn/X) about building their partnership with AI? Optional means optional — the discount is already theirs.
